Is there a way to import/paste performer names in bulk as opposed to cycling through each dot one by one and setting the performer name one by one? I have almost 170 performers, so some type of full performer list that makes it easy to manage player names and paste names from a source like excel, would be useful especially for larger groups. Sorry, this is probably a feature request, but I wasn't sure if I wasn't seeing some existing functionality.

Hi bjindrich,

Yes this is a feature request; this functionality does not currently exist in EnVision. This is something that we have considered in the past though and we would love to hear your thoughts on it. Being able to import data from a source like Excel could be very useful for larger groups.

Since Envision needs to match names to individual performers in the drill, maybe it's not so much an import, as it is a grid view that provides the ability to set the fields available on the Performer Editor panel. This Performer List window/grid (which should sort by primary equipment by default - not sure if I see a reason to sort by anything else) would have a row for each performer, and a column for each of the attributes in the Performer Editor (name, label, equipment, chair, etc.). In addition to allowing individual names to be typed or pasted, if this grid allowed for pasting name names from a source like excel, that would do the trick. This would have to be a large window, since I'd want to see as many of the attributes and as many rows of performers as possible without scrolling.
